Fresh and Delicious // Winter Fruits
Did you know wintertime is the best time for fruits like oranges and pomegranates to grow? That might seem pretty crazy since fruits and vegetables don't grow well in Utah during the winter, but it's true! Always in Season // Fantastic Frozen Berries
Winter is just around the corner! Even though we love holidays and snowmen, fresh fruits and vegetables can be harder to come by during this season. Incorporating frozen fruits and vegetables into our meals is one way we can get enough of these food groups through the winter months.
